第3节 DSP系统硬件实现基础
DSP系统硬件实现基础
目标:设计高性能DSP系统或DSP IP核
- 一般DSP系统:
Xilinx:Simulink + System Generator
Altera:Simulink + DSP Bulider
IP core或已有模块
自己用硬件描述语言设计 - 高性能DSP系统或IP核:
Re-timing
Pipelining
Parallel Processing
Distributed Algorithms……
DSP算法与应用
DSP系统特点
- 实时处理
- 数据驱动
- 根据系统需求决定DSP系统的实现方式

举例
- 移动通信基站:复杂、稳定性、灵活性
Processors + DSP + FPGA - 雷达信号处理:运算量大、实时、灵活性、稳定性
DSP + FPGA - 手机:低功耗、低成本、体积小、一定的灵活性
Processors + ASIC - 蓝牙耳机:低功耗、低成本、体积小
ASIC + Processors - ……
DSP硬件实现
- DSP算法的几种描述方法;
- 几个基本概念:
Iteration
Iteration Period
Critical Path
Latency
Critical Loop
Loop Bound
Iteration Bound -
DSP算法实现:
流水线与并行处理
重定时
Folding/Unfolding
Systolic Array
……


